I think it's cool - why not have a sporty looking bike if its a 125?

In defence of 125s : On the open road I definetly prefer riding around on a 600 but in London my cbr 125 was ace. Nice and narrow so filtering was a doddle and the fuel economy was so good I almost forgot it needed petrol the intervals between filling up were so big. At the lights it lacked acceleration but in corners what kept me from keeping up with bigger bikes was a lack of skill. I can see why people have a full licence but choose to keep their 125.
